[Ada] Avoid reading past end of file when checking for BOM

This patch makes sure that the routine Check_For_BOM cannot
read past the end of file. In practice it is probably the
case that this cannot cause a real error, but valgrind can
see that this is happening. So this change will avoid the
annoying false positive from valgrind. It's not worth setting
up a valgrind test for this very minor issue, and there is
no way to generate a real test that fails, so no test.

Tested on x86_64-pc-linux-gnu, committed on trunk

2013-09-10  Robert Dewar  <dewar@adacore.com>

	* sinput.adb (Check_For_BOM): Avoid reading past end of file.
